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$3,734 in Anna, TX versus $2,336 in Barcelona.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$4,345 in Anna, TX versus $3,475 in Barcelona.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,957 in Anna, TX versus $4,614 in Barcelona.

Living in Anna, TX is roughly 60% more expensive than Barcelona, driven mainly by Monthly Utilities & Internet.

Both cities are pricier than the global median: Anna, TX 179% above, Barcelona 74% above.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$2,611 in Anna, TX and $1,538 in Barcelona.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Anna, TX pays 146%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.

Dining out: $79 in Anna, TX vs $70 in Barcelona for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$367 vs $318 per month, with Barcelona cheaper across the board.
